git撤销本地commit并撤销远程不小心push的commit

http://blog.csdn.net/xs20691718/article/details/51901161

在使用git时,push到远端后发现commit了多余的文件,或者希望能够回退到以前的版本。

先在本地回退到相应的版本:

git reset --hard <版本号>
// 注意使用 --hard 参数会抛弃当前工作区的修改
// 使用 --soft 参数的话会回退到之前的版本,但是保留当前工作区的修改,可以重新提交

你可能感兴趣的:(git撤销本地commit并撤销远程不小心push的commit)